Middle School ELA Tutor (Saturdays)

ELA Tutor (Saturdays) – West Bronx

Are you passionate about helping students build strong literacy skills? Do you want to make a meaningful impact in the lives of middle school students while helping them develop study strategies for long-term success? If so, Toolkit Tutors wants to hear from you!

About Us

Toolkit Tutors is a high-impact tutoring company dedicated to helping students master academic content while developing essential study skills. We provide in-person, small-group tutoring for NYC public schools, supporting students who need extra help in English Language Arts (ELA), Mathematics, and Social Studies.

The Job

We are looking for an ELA tutor to work in-person with middle school students in small groups (1-4 students per group) at a school in the West Bronx. Students will need support with reading comprehension, writing skills, and critical thinking strategies. Our model emphasizes structured, skill-building instruction that helps students improve both academically and in their ability to study effectively.

Tutors will work in person on Saturdays from March 8 to June 14, 2025, providing 3-4 hours of instruction per day.

Responsibilities

  • Provide engaging, structured ELA instruction in small-group settings.
  • Support students in reading comprehension, writing, and vocabulary development.
  • Integrate study skills strategies (e.g., note-taking, active reading) into sessions.
  • Take daily attendance using a personal device (mobile phone) or a school-issued laptop.
  • Communicate professionally with school staff and Toolkit Tutors leadership.

We are looking for tutors who meet the following criteria:

  • Bachelor’s degree from an accredited institution (completed, or close to completion showing strong academic performance).
  • At least one year of experience teaching or tutoring in a school or educational setting.
  • Experience working with urban school communities and an understanding of the challenges students face.
  • Strong content knowledge in ELA, including reading strategies, writing instruction, and grammar.
  • Punctual, reliable, and committed to student success.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to engage students effectively.
  • Ability to commute to the school location in the West Bronx.
  • DOE fingerprint clearance strongly preferred.
  • Pay Rate of $35 per hour
  • Paid sick leave
  • Paid training and PD opportunities
